Number identification is a fundamental skill for children ages 6-9, serving as the building block for more complex mathematical concepts. Parents and teachers should prioritize this skill for several reasons.
Firstly, number identification fosters a child’s confidence in mathematics, establishing a strong foundation for future learning. Mastery of numbers enables children to grasp other numerical concepts, such as addition and subtraction, which emerge in later grades. Secondly, recognizing numbers enhances everyday life skills, such as telling time, counting money, and understanding calendars. This skill helps children navigate their world more effectively and builds essential problem-solving abilities.
Moreover, strong number identification is linked to improved academic performance. Research indicates that a solid grasp of numbers in early education can lead to greater success in later math-related subjects, paving the way for STEM opportunities. It also supports cognitive development by encouraging children to recognize patterns, think critically, and make connections between concepts.
By focusing on number identification, parents and teachers lay a rich and meaningful groundwork in mathematics for children. Investing in this foundational skill ultimately fosters a lifelong positive attitude toward learning and a deeper understanding of mathematical principles, ensuring a path toward academic achievement and personal growth.
